Exporting a Catalog

You can export a catalog to a known path or a shared folder called CommerceCatalogs on the computer on which Commerce Server is installed. Exporting a catalog can make your catalog portable. For example, you can share your catalog with your business partner, or outsource development and maintenance of your catalogs.

To export a catalog you must have a shared folder on the Commerce Server computer available to you. Contact your system administrator to set up a shared folder for you.

Catalogs can be exported in either Extensible Markup Language (XML) or comma-separated values (CSV) file format.

To export a catalog

  1. In Catalogs, click Catalog Editor.

  2. In the Catalogs screen, select the catalog you want to export, and then click Export on the toolbar.

  3. Select whether you want to export the catalog in XML or CSV file format from the drop-down list.

  4. In the ExportCatalog dialog box, type the complete path and file name of a catalog that can be written to by the server in the Export File box (such as, C:\CatalogsforBusiness\SportsCatalog.xml), and then click Continue.

    If you are exporting to the CommerceCatalogs shared folder on which you have Commerce Server installed, you do not need to specify the complete path. For example, you can type, SportsCatalogs.xml.

The catalog is exported to the specified location, from which you can copy it and use it elsewhere.
